Safety

Bunk beds can be a convenient and space-saving solution for families with several children sharing a small bedroom. However, they can also be dangerous for the parents. The risks can be minimized by taking a little caution. First, make sure your bunk beds are made of solid wood. You should avoid anything flimsy that could break or fall and end up hurting your kids. You must also ensure that there aren't any loose parts or gaps that could entangle your child.

Another thing to look out for is guardrails on the top bunk. They should be at least 5 inches higher than the mattress and extend to the edges of the frame of the bed. They shouldn't have gaps that could allow children to climb out of the rails or get caught in between the rails. The guardrails should not raise the top of the bed to the point that children are unable to use pillows or blankets.

It is important to teach your children not to hang items off the bunks, for example belts, jump ropes or jewelry, as this can be a risk of strangulation. This will help keep them from getting injured by these items or having to climb up and down the ladder wearing these items. Some bunks have storage, so you can keep the items there instead of putting them on the beds.

Also, be sure that the bunks are not placed directly beneath hanging ceiling fans or light fixtures because this could result in the child to fall if it is sleeping on the upper double bunk bed on top and bottom. Also, do not put them in front of or close to windows since this could result in falling in the event that your child falls through the window.

For added safety You can choose metal bunk beds over wooden ones. They will last longer because they are more durable and robust than wooden ones. They are less likely to warp and get damaged in time. You should be aware, however, that they sound louder than wooden ones. If your child is sensitive to noise, you might want the wooden option.

Space

Bunk beds are not only fun for kids, but they also save space. Look for models that feature built-in shelves or drawers to make the room more tidy. Choose from a variety of finishes and colors, including sleek metals to complement any decor.

If your kids don't share a room, consider a loft bed with a separate lower bed. These beds typically have a ladder or stairway to access the top. These beds are an excellent choice for guest rooms. Some of these beds come with the added benefit of an under-bed desk or chest. These three-in-one beds are ideal for storage, sleeping and studying in a small area.

A full-over-twin bunk bed is another alternative. It comes with a twin on top, and a full at the bottom. This model is perfect for siblings who have an extensive age gap. Younger children can sleep on the top 4 sleeper bunk beds, and enjoy a view of the world from above, while older children and teens can enjoy the security of their own private double bed bunk desk below.

Look for models that include an trundle or pull-out twin mattress underneath the bottom bunk for additional sleeping space. They can be used as a single bed or together to accommodate four people. Some bunk beds come with the option of slat kits that let you use any size mattress.

Bunks made of wood are durable and warm, while metal models have a clean, modern aesthetic. You can find designs that blend these elements to create a unique design, such as the rustic-chic reclaimed wood bunks for sale. Certain metal models feature polished, sleek finishes to give a modern appearance.

Pick a bunk bed that is easy to set up and move. It is possible to find a model which folds flat and can be put on top of the bed or against a stud wall. You can also find models that can be tucked into the wall, or can transform into sofa beds.

Budget

Bunk beds are a great option to share a room and save valuable floor space, which can be used to store things or for playing. Finding the right bunk bed can be a challenge with the many options available. In addition to making sure that the beds fit properly within your home and complies with safety standards, you'll also want to ensure that the design of the double bunk bed on top bed is appropriate for your space.

Certain designs are more effective than others in maximizing vertical space. IKEA's Mydal For instance, it is a low-slung bed that is ideal for rooms with roofs that slope. While it's not a traditional bunk, its low-to-ground design makes it easy for children to climb into and out of.

Other bunk bed configurations include an L-shaped design that's great for spaces with limited floor space or an angled ladder that lets the bottom bunk open to make it easier to access. Another alternative is a staircase bed which occupies less space than a ladder, however it is more difficult for younger children to climb. Some models even have built-in shelves or drawers to provide additional storage.

When you're looking for a budget, the cost of a bunk bed will vary significantly depending on the quality and the materials used. For example all-wood bunks tend to be more expensive than metal ones but they are identically beautiful and are durable enough to last for a long time. Make sure to consider the weight capacity and overall design of any wood bunk you're thinking of buying as well.

Metal bunks can also be an excellent option if you're looking for an elegant, minimalist design. They typically don't have as much room for storage as wood models, and might not be suitable to larger children.

It's a great idea visit a furniture shop to look at the options in person after you've made your decision on which bunk beds is ideal for your family. It's an excellent idea to bring your kids along, as it will help them envision their new bedroom and help them feel more comfortable with the choice. Bring a measuring tape, as you will need to know how high the top bunk is from the floor and the overall thickness of your mattress.
